What is Apple Snickers Salad?
If you’ve never tried this dish before, you might be curious about what it entails. Contrary to what the name suggests, this isn’t your standard leafy green salad. Instead, apple Snickers salad is a delightful dessert disguised as a side dish. This dish combines crisp, diced apples, chunks of Snickers candy bars, and a smooth whipped topping, creating a delightful blend of sweet and tangy flavors with a satisfying mix of textures.
The beauty of this salad is its versatility. You can serve it as a dessert, a snack, or even a fun side dish for lunch. Everyone loves it kids and adults alike because it combines the nostalgic sweetness of Snickers with the crisp, refreshing bite of apples.
Ingredients “Recipe for Apple Snickers Salad”
One of the highlights of this recipe is its simplicity, requiring only a few basic ingredients. Here’s what you’ll need:

Ingredient | Quantity | Notes |
Granny Smith Apples | 4-5 | Crisp and tart, perfect for balance. |
Snickers Candy Bars | 4 large | Cut into bite-sized pieces. |
Whipped Topping (Cool Whip) | 8 oz | Thawed for easy mixing. |
Vanilla Pudding Mix | 1 package | Optional, adds extra creaminess. |
Milk | 1 cup | Needed only if using pudding mix. |
Ingredient Tips and Substitutions
- Apples: While Granny Smith apples are ideal for their tartness, you can also use sweeter varieties like Fuji, Gala, or Honeycrisp for a slightly different flavor profile.
- Snickers Bars: For a nut-free alternative, replace Snickers with a different candy bar such as Milky Way or Twix.
- Whipped Topping: For a lighter version, you can opt for reduced-fat whipped topping or even whipped Greek yogurt for a tangy twist.
How to Make This Easy Recipe for Apple Snickers Salad
Once you have all your ingredients ready, it’s time to begin. Don’t worry this recipe is as simple as it is delicious.
Step 1: Prep the Apples
Start by washing and drying your apples. Core them, then chop them into bite-sized pieces. If you’re worried about browning, toss the apple chunks with a small amount of lemon juice. This will help maintain their vibrant color.
Quick Tip: Want your apples extra crisp? Place them in ice-cold water for 10 minutes before chopping.
Step 2: Chop the Snickers Bars
Next, grab your Snickers bars and chop them into small pieces. You’ll want the chunks to be evenly sized so they mix well throughout the salad. Try to resist eating too many of these while you prep (we know it’s tempting).
Step 3: Prepare the Creamy Base
In a large mixing bowl, combine the whipped topping and vanilla pudding mix (if you’re using it). Slowly add milk while whisking to create a smooth, creamy mixture. This base gives the salad its luscious texture.
Skip the pudding mix? No worries the whipped topping on its own will still work perfectly.
Step 4: Combine Ingredients
Gently fold the chopped apples and Snickers pieces into the creamy base. Make sure everything is evenly coated, but be careful not to overmix, as you want the Snickers pieces to remain intact.
Step 5: Chill and Serve
Place the salad in a serving dish and chill it in the refrigerator for a minimum of 30 minutes. This gives the flavors time to meld together and guarantees the salad is perfectly chilled when served.
Serving Tip: Garnish with a drizzle of caramel sauce or a sprinkle of crushed Snickers pieces for an extra-special presentation.

Fun Variations and Additions
Looking to improve this salad? Here are some creative ideas to make it your own:
- Add Marshmallows: Mini marshmallows add a chewy texture and extra sweetness.
- Mix in Other Fruits: Bananas, grapes, or strawberries can add new dimensions to the dish.
- Top with Caramel or Chocolate Syrup: A drizzle of syrup takes this dessert to new heights.
- Try a Crunchy Topping: Sprinkle crushed graham crackers, granola, or nuts for added texture.
FAQs About Apple Snickers Salad
Can I Make This Salad Ahead of Time?
Yes! You can prepare the salad up to 12 hours in advance. However, for the best texture, it’s a good idea to add the Snickers chunks just before serving. This keeps them from getting soggy.
What Apples Work Best for This Recipe?
Granny Smith apples are a classic choice because their tartness balances the sweetness of the Snickers. If you prefer a milder flavor, opt for Honeycrisp or Gala apples.
Can I Make a Healthier Version of This Salad?
Definitely. Use sugar-free pudding mix, light whipped topping, and reduce the amount of Snickers bars. You can also substitute with dark chocolate for a lower-sugar option.
What’s the Best Way to Serve This Salad?
Serve it chilled in a large bowl or divide it into individual dessert cups for a more polished presentation.
